Rowing notches five victories on day one at the Longhorn Invitational

March 18, 2011

Photo Gallery 

AUSTIN, Texas - The Texas Rowing team kicked off the three-day Longhorn Invitational, with victories over Louisville and Wisconsin, Friday evening at Lady Bird Lake. The Horns posted wins in the varsity eight, second varsity eight, first varsity four, first novice eight and second novice eight races.

The Longhorns first varsity eight boat of coxswain Emma Dirks, stroke Jennifer VanderMaarel, Laurel McCaig, Jacqueline Gorcyca, Anna Thomson, Jelena Zunic, Jessica Glennie, Sydney Boyes and Felicia Izaguirre-Werner defeated Louisville in its race, 7:15.1-to-7:32.8.

In the second varsity eight race, the Horns' crew of coxswain Megan Kelly, stroke Charity McDonald, Courtney Nicklas, Hannah Moon, Chelsea Burns, Olivia Nail, Tea Vrtlar, Katarina Susac and Karli Sheahan bested the Cardinals, 7:30.1-to-7:52.0.

Texas' first varsity four boat of coxswain Katie Sayre, Taylor Parker, Tejana Lovric, Devon Clark and Sarah Pederson completed the race in 8:21.9 to down Louisville (8:50.3).

The Horns' first novice eight boat notched a victory against UL as well, winning the race, 7:59.1-to-8:25.3. Texas' second novice boat matched up with Wisconsin and defeated the Badgers, 8:11.5-to-8:19.4.

The Longhorn Invitational is a 2,000 meter dual-style race held annually on Lady Bird Lake. Texas and the seven other crews are competing in head-to-head races in each race of the weekend.

Texas returns to Lady Bird Lake on Saturday, March 19 when it hosts the second and third sessions of the Longhorn Invitational. The second session will begin at 8 a.m. Central, while the third session begins at 4 p.m. Central.
